LCSC music program sets guitar and saxophone performances
05-01-08
The Lewis-Clark State College music program will have a student guitar recital on May 10 and a saxophone recital on May 11, both on the LCSC campus.
The guitar recital is set for 3 p.m. at the LCSC Music Building, located on the corner of 7th Street and 11th Avenue in Lewiston. The recital will feature the students of LCSC guitar instructor Tim Bell performing a variety of classical music.
The saxophone recital will be at 3 p.m. in the Silverthorne Theatre. LCSC music professor Bill Perconti will premier a solo work written for him by American East Coast composter Allan Black, and the LCSC Saxophone Quarter will add a bass saxophone to perform saxophone quintet music by Grainger.
Both concerts are free and open to the public.
